Abstract :
Many two-dimensional Markov models whose state space is a semi-infinite strip (i.e. finite in one dimension and infinite in the other) can be solved efficiently by means of spectral expansion. This method and its application are described in the context of an M/M//N queue with general breakdowns and repairs. The results of experiments aimed at evaluating the relative merits of the spectral expansion and the matrix-geometric solutions are also presented.
